Know the Symptoms of a Stroke – Act FAST
Stroke is the third leading cause of death in the United States. With Stroke – Time is Brain. For every minute that brain cells are deprived of oxygen during stroke, the likelihood of brain damage increases. Act FAST represents four key signs of identifying a possible stroke: face, arms, speech and time. Here’s how it works:
Face - Ask the person to smile. Does one side of the face droop?
Arms - Ask the person to raise both arms. Does one arm drift downward?
Speech - Ask the person to repeat a simple sentence. Are the words slurred? Can the patient repeat the sentence correctly?
Time - Get the affected person to a hospital right away to receive the most effective treatment.
If a person is having trouble with these basic commands, call 911 immediately.
Are You at Risk for a Stroke?
It is possible to have a stroke without the risk factors listed below. However, the more risk factors you have, the greater your likelihood of having a stroke. If you have a number of risk factors, ask your doctor what you can do to reduce your risk. Risk factors for stroke include:
• Poor Diet
• Smoking
• Drug Use
• Certain Medical Conditions
• Age
• Gender
• Genetic Factors
• Ethnic Background
